What is Whitewater Rafting on the Lehigh River?
Whitewater rafting on the Lehigh River is an adventure sport that involves navigating a raft through the rapids of the river. The Lehigh River, located in the Pocono Mountains of Pennsylvania, offers a variety of rapids that cater to different skill levels, making it a popular destination for whitewater rafting enthusiasts.
During a whitewater rafting trip, participants are seated in a raft and use paddles to navigate through the rapids. The intensity of the rapids can vary, ranging from gentle Class I rapids to more challenging Class III and IV rapids. Trained guides accompany each rafting group to ensure safety and provide instructions on how to navigate the river.
Whitewater rafting on the Lehigh River is suitable for both beginners and experienced rafters. Beginners can start with the easier rapids and gradually build up their skills and confidence. Experienced rafters can take on the more challenging rapids for an adrenaline-pumping adventure.

The Hidden Secret of Whitewater Rafting on the Lehigh River
The Lehigh River may be known for its thrilling rapids and scenic beauty, but it also holds a hidden secret - its rich history. As you navigate through the rapids, you will come across remnants of the past, including old canal locks and historic buildings.
One of the highlights of whitewater rafting on the Lehigh River is passing through the Lehigh Gorge State Park. This stretch of the river is not only known for its challenging rapids but also for its fascinating geological features. As you paddle through the gorge, you will be surrounded by towering cliffs and rock formations that tell the story of the river's formation over millions of years.
Another hidden secret of the Lehigh River is its diverse wildlife. As you raft downstream, keep an eye out for bald eagles, ospreys, and herons that call the river and its surroundings home. You may even spot deer and other animals along the riverbanks.

Whitewater Rafting on the Lehigh River: Safety Tips
While whitewater rafting on the Lehigh River is an exciting and thrilling adventure, it is important to prioritize safety. Here are some safety tips to keep in mind:
1. Wear a life jacket and helmet: Always wear a properly fitted life jacket and helmet. These safety gears can save your life in case of an accident.
2. Listen to your guide: Pay attention to the instructions given by your guide and follow their guidance. They have the experience and knowledge to keep you safe on the river.
3. Stay hydrated: Whitewater rafting can be physically demanding, so make sure to drink plenty of water to stay hydrated throughout the trip.
4. Protect yourself from the sun: Apply sunscreen and wear a hat and sunglasses to protect yourself from the sun's harmful rays. The reflection of the water can intensify the sun's rays, so it is important to take precautions.
5. Be aware of your surroundings: Keep an eye out for obstacles in the river, such as rocks and fallen trees. Stay alert and react quickly to avoid any potential hazards.
By following these safety tips, you can ensure a safe and enjoyable whitewater rafting experience on the Lehigh River.
